With the rise of streaming services, many viewers are left wondering, are you paying too much? Each platform offers a unique library of content, but prices can vary significantly. For instance, subscription fees for popular services like Netflix, Hulu, and Disney+ range from $6.99 to $19.99 per month, depending on the plan you choose. To help you decide if you’re getting good value for your money, consider making a comparison of the available plans and the content offered. Analyzing how often you use each service can also provide insight into whether your current subscriptions fit your viewing habits.
Furthermore, it’s essential to take into account any additional costs that may come with these streaming platforms. Some services offer add-ons for premium content or channels, which can significantly increase your monthly expenses.
